Mike Yarmo bought a struggling distributor & turned it into a local powerhouse in a different niche — then sold for 5x.Key points from Mike's acquisition:Owner was disengaged, retiring, and looking to sell his food distribution companyCompany was 25 years old but had terrible marginsMike & team acquired for low 7 figures, or ~2x earningsPivoted the company, grew aggressively over next few yearsSold 5 years later for 5x earnings, and 5x original acquisition priceReach Mike Yarmo:On Twitter: @michaelyarmoSubscribe to his newsletterOfficial episode page & full show notes at AcquiringMinds.co:How to Buy a $2m Dying Business Then Sell It for 5X
